Has anyone taken the Global Gourmet Cooking Class on the Riviera or Marina? They have a very ambiguous description of the class offering (Their verbiage: This class was designed to help you better appreciate the cuisines of the world, and to explore the spices, cooking techniques, ingredients, vessels and preparation of foods from around the world. )

 

We were curious if anyone took this class and has any insight to the recipes/techniques.

The Culinary Center is a marvelous innovation, and there are a number of very knowledgeable and accomplished instructors, but with the classes being formed as they are, it is impossible to get more complex than the ingredients of a sauce, or how to judge the done-ness of meat without cutting into it.

183046.jpg

Any of the Classes are interesting, different ways to spend a few hours, and nothing more. They are diversions, not instructions in the truest sense of the word.
